Thousands in Moldova call for government's resignation

Description

Thousands of demonstrators gather in the Moldovan capital of Chisinau to demand the resignation of the government and the dissolution of the parliament. Moldova last month elected pro-European Maia Sandu to the presidency, earning her a surprise victory over pro-Russian incumbent Igor Dodon. IMAGES
